Gary Coleman (1968-2010) was an American actor and comedian, widely recognized for his portrayal of Arnold Jackson in the popular television series "Diff'rent Strokes" during the late 1970s and early 1980s. Coleman's fame skyrocketed due to his diminutive stature, distinctive voice, and comedic timing, making him one of the most iconic child stars of his time.

    Born on February 8, 1968, in Zion, Illinois, Gary Coleman faced numerous health challenges throughout his life, including a congenital kidney disease which stunted his growth. Standing at only 4 feet 8 inches tall, Coleman's unique appearance captivated audiences and propelled him to stardom.

    Throughout his prolific acting career, Coleman's most notable role as Arnold Jackson earned him immense popularity, delivering memorable catchphrases such as "What'chu talkin' 'bout, Willis?" His charisma and comedic talent endeared him to audiences worldwide, solidifying his place in television history.

    Following the conclusion of "Diff'rent Strokes" in 1986, Coleman encountered personal and financial difficulties, including legal troubles and financial mismanagement. Despite these challenges, he continued to pursue acting and appeared in various television shows and films over the years.

    Gary Coleman's untimely demise occurred on May 28, 2010, at the age of 42, due to complications from a brain hemorrhage. His contributions to the entertainment industry, particularly his iconic role as Arnold Jackson in "Diff'rent Strokes," continue to be remembered and cherished, cementing his status as a beloved figure in American television.
